How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West Sacramento?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
West Sacramento Studio Apartments | $1,826 | $957 | $8,620 |
West Sacramento 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,263 | $1,020 | $9,227 |
West Sacramento 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,693 | $1,495 | $10,000+ |
West Sacramento 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,027 | $2,000 | $7,287 |
West Sacramento 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,475 | $4,475 | $4,475 |

Getting Around West Sacramento, CA
Walk Score®
44 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
62 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
25 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
